This weekend, the New York Times Magazine discovered all the joy and sorrow of digital ubiquity [nyt], viewed primarily through the lens of the Facebook newsfeed and the twittiverse. Thanks to Big Blogger and tweetaholic Mónica Guzmán [#], we learn that, in addition to keeping a weblog, King County Exec Ron Sims is also hooked on the 140 character train.
On his twitter feed [#], you’ll find newsy updates, commentary on bad officiating, and the occasional I SAW U:
You’ll also find a simple explanation of why he does it: “I enjoy it“. As far as twitter users go, his ranks on the informative and engaging side. Any other government officials you’d like to have filling your twitter feeds?
